The Van Zandt Raven in the Mt Baker foothills

The Raven is a beautiful 1100 ft. sq. custom apt. above our garage. There are two bedrooms, each with a comfortable queen bed. There is one bathroom with a 6 ft. tub and shower with a slate surround.The kitchen is fully equipped including a dishwasher. There is plenty of parking and two stairways to The Raven. The main entrance is on the east side of the building while the west side has stairs from the deck. The deck is very private and has a great forest view. The Raven is a very tasteful and comfortable apt. with bamboo floors and birch trim milled from trees right here on our property. There is a TV with a DVD player. The heat is quiet,cozy and hypoallergenic radiant floor heat. There are lovely southern views of our valley from the living room and kitchen windows.
The Raven is NOT a party vacation rental. The only people allowed, unless by special approval, are those who booked the Raven. We do not allow smoking anywhere on the property and do not allow pets. Money from the damage deposit can also be used if a guest does not clean the Raven to a satisfactory condition (the expectation is clearly defined in the welcome note guests receive when arriving)
The Raven is located on a 45 acre paradise located on a quiet country road about halfway from the bustling small city of Bellingham and the world renowned Mt. Baker Ski Area and North Cascades National Park. Hiking abounds in the summer and fall with epic skiing in the winter months. Starting in later November and going thru January is the returning of the salmon with it lots of bald eagles nearby. It's only a five minute drive from the Raven to spectacular eagle viewing. Also in early winter you can hear great horned owls hooting while they start their mating season. Spring and summer bring many a bird and a literal cacophony of frogs in our wetlands. If you feel like a walk in the woods we have a trail thru our truly majestic forest with mature cedar, Douglas fir, hemlock, big leaf maple,birch, and red alder. Summertime is beyond description here in the Southfork valley with sun and the river to swim in. Because we live on a quiet country road with little traffic a stroll down it is a relaxing way to start or end your day and you might even meet some of our neighbors who regular;y walk, run or bike. Across the valley is a seasonal waterfall the is quite spectacular. Come join us for a country respite!
